Output 033d8aaae4602183d553ed83d4e5951ec335a6d22e50e533f2a052d662e377a1:0

value
68810812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b2f190eee316a6c158c5305c1b990b1bb451918 OP_EQUAL
address
375xDHCX942SqXe7v6jZWkhMxdcc4HDcYe
transaction
033d8aaae4602183d553ed83d4e5951ec335a6d22e50e533f2a052d662e377a1
confirmations
291953
spent
true